I sat with 7 ladies who either shared a package or got their own .. drove our waiter nuts with so many. The one comment I have is .. dont forget to bring the stickers with you to dinner (my roomie kept forgetting hers). You need to peel off the sticker of the bottle you want that night and give it to the waiter to redeem each bottle. they have low, medium and higher priced packages... our table got mostly the low priced version.. but two ladies shared the medium one and liked those wines a lot. You seem to be able to get more than one of the same bottle if you like it.. or switch around.. sorry, dont have a copy of the list.. i bet zydocruiser has it on his site. There are 3 levels of package based on wine quality - for the 5 bottle packages the prices are roughly $135,$158, $178 plus gratuity. There are 6 or 7 choices in each price range. Just off the Freedom, 8-day -- we bought the five-bottle wine package the day we sailed form a table they had set up in the lobby. We decided on the premium package because we liked the offerings in that package -- it came to $193 after adding the gratuity. Each package had 10 choices, a mix of whites and reds. All of the bottles we selected were very good.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
